Embracing the Harmonious Path #2173

Embracing the Harmonious Path In ancient halls where wisdom flows, Aristotle’s light still softly glows, Virtue balanced, pure and bright, Guiding us through day and night. Stoic voices stern and clear, Teach us not to bow to fear, Virtue's essence, heart's true gain, In apatheia, peace we attain. On Christian shores, these streams did meet, In faith’s embrace, they found their seat, Logos spoken, Word made flesh, In this union, spirits refresh. Aristotle’s golden mean, In divine light now is seen, Stoic strength and Christian grace, Together form a sacred space. Virtue’s journey, life’s true aim, Not for fleeting, worldly fame, But a path to deeper worth, A glimpse of heaven here on earth. In reflections, quiet, deep, Ancient whispers gently seep, Calling us to virtue’s way, In our hearts, they softly sway. Wisdom’s confluence, clear and bright, Guides us through the darkest night, Good and true and beautiful, In these virtues, find our goal. So let us walk this harmonious path, With ancient wisdom, faith, and heart, In virtue’s light, we’ll find our way, Closer to the divine each day. -Steven G. Lee (July 4, 2024)
